description: 'The following analytic identifies the execution of `adfind.exe` with
specific command-line arguments related to Active Directory queries. It leverages
data from Endpoint Detection and Response (EDR) agents, focusing on process names,
command-line arguments, and parent processes. This activity is significant because
`adfind.exe` is a powerful tool often used by threat actors like Wizard Spider and
FIN6 to gather sensitive AD information. If confirmed malicious, this activity could
allow attackers to map the AD environment, facilitating further attacks such as
privilege escalation or lateral movement.'
